qq:800819103
在线客服,实时响应联系方式:
13318873961明白IIS中的反向代理概念
在深入探讨怎样设置反向代理之前,首先需要明确什么是反向代理。与传统的正向代理服务不同,反向代理服务器位于客户端和目标服务器之间,并作为客户端的接收来自外部网络的请求。它不仅能够隐藏实际的目标服务器信息,越来越系统的平安性,还能实现负载均衡、缓存数据等功能,从而提升整个网络环境的服务能力。在IIS中配置反向代理时,用户可以通过URL重写模块来指定哪些流量需要被定向到哪个内部服务,例如可以设置将所有对特定域名的请求转发一个或多个内网IP地址上的服务器处理。
配置步骤详述
实施反向代理的具体步骤相对纷乱但逻辑明确。步是确保IIS上已经安装了所需的URL重写模块。接着,需要在网站的Web.config文件中添加相应的规则来定义怎样进行流量导向。例如,可以编写一个条件语句检查请求是否针对特定域名,并使用rewrite节点配置反向代理到的目标服务器地址,这通常是通过设置serverVariable元素中的REMOTE_ADDR为内部IP实现的。此外,在某些场景下,还也许需要考虑对不同HTTP方法(如GET、POST)进行差异化处理,以满足不同的业务需求。
在IIS中实施反向代理IP配置是优化网络架构和提升服务快速的有效手段之一,通过上述步骤能够很好地将外部请求精准转发目标服务器上,进而实现包括负载均衡在内的多种功能。正确设置这些规则需要对HTTP协议及IIS系统有深刻的明白,但一旦顺利部署,则可以为用户提供更加稳定、平安的服务体验,并且在管理纷乱的网络环境时提供强劲拥护。